I've been rewatching some episodes of Princess Tutu this weekend, and I noticed in the post-fight scene episode 20.5, during the oh-so-allegorical conversation between Racheal, Fakir, and Tutu, the use of one of my new favorite pieces of classical music: a bit by Chopin that also happens to appear during episode 51 of FMA (at about 9 minute mark through the 11 minute mark, where Stuff happens and if you've seen 51 you know the Stuff I'm talking about.)

I went looking for this music guide for PT to compare and see if the song pieces have the same title, but sadly the guide only goes up to ep 13, meaning no info on episode 20.5. still, I'm certain they're the same.

I did notice something else in examining this guide, though: Almost all the Fakir scenes and the Ahiru/Fakir scenes in episodes 9 through 11 use Chopin . Heee.

I wasn't listening for it before, but now I'm curious. And I wonder if Chopin is one of main Ahiru/Fakir musical themes.
